On June 26, 2024, Cloami, SSDC, and LILO hosted a gathering titled "Collaborative Commerce: Integrating Trends, Technology, and Fulfillment" at The Sage Cihapit, Bandung. Attended by 12 prominent Bandung-based fashion brands including Gonegani, Calla the Label, and Elzatta, the event focused on optimizing supply chain in the fashion industry.

The gathering focused on optimizing supply chains in the fashion industry, exploring trends, technology, and operations. Cloami, a platform for apparel production, discussed trends like sustainable materials, fast vs. slow fashion, and social media's impact. Kristina Astaman, Cloami's Sr. Business Development Manager, emphasized the need for fashion brands to align their production and commercialization strategies with evolving consumer behaviors.
SSDC and LILO shared insights on webstore marketing and apparel logistics. Burqi Baituni from SSDC emphasized the importance of a strong website infrastructure. Meanwhile, Reza Zulkarnaen from LILO highlighted the need for integrated operations to fulfill orders and improve customer satisfaction.

Following the presentations, participants actively engaged in discussions about the industry potential and strategies to improve their business supply chain. Beyond providing a glimpse into the future of the industry, the event empowered business owners to network and form partnerships.

The rapid evolution of the fashion industry demands continuous innovation, particularly in supply chain management. This gathering aimed to provide a comprehensive understanding of fashion trends, garment production processes, and strategies to enhance operational efficiency.
